Harsch quotes a former aide describing Sankara as “an idealist, demanding, rigorous, an organizer.” This discipline and seriousness started with himself. His informal style of leadership was in a league of its own. He also championed environmental conservation with tree-planting campaigns and greening projects. In 1984, his government, defying skepticism from the donor agencies, organized the vaccination of 2 million children in a little over two weeks. Total cereal production rose by 75% between 19. Demanding, idealist, rigorous, an organizerĪccording to Ernest Harsch, author of a recent biography of Sankara, Burkinabe built for the first time scores of schools, health centers, water reservoirs, and nearly 100 km of rail, with little or no external assistance. Intellectual and civic education were systematically integrated with military training and soldiers were required to work in local community development projects. In Sankara’s Burkina, no one was above farm work, or graveling roads–not even the president, government ministers or army officers.
